Subject: Prototype Shipment to Veldane Test Lab

Dear Records Team,

Tomorrow we dispatch the Quillhart R-4 prototype enclosure to the Veldane materials lab in Ostermere. The unit travels in its padded transit case, sealed and logged under project Fennick. Please file the outbound manifest and retain a copy of the chain-of-custody form. Note for the file the exact hand-over condition stated below.

handover note for yagef-bagep: the drudor pelius courier leaves the kasdor zorvan norir ledger at gate 8016 under passcode 755406

Runbook: Brindlekit component library versioning. Consumers pin a major version; patch bumps auto-roll. If a tenant reports broken widgets after a release, check whether their app resolved a new major without a migration. Do not roll back the registry — pin the consumer instead. Escalate to the Plumeline team only if two or more tenants are affected. The resolver behaves according to the following configuration values.

settings of tagef-bawif:
DRUIX_HOST=druix.zemvarlabs.internal
DRUIX_PORT=8000

Heads up on the vendor admin table in Ledgerloom: bulk edits are live again after last week's rollback, but the guardrails are stricter now. You can't change payment terms and tax class in the same batch anymore — the validator will reject the whole lot, not just the bad rows. If a vendor batch gets stuck in "pending review," don't retry it; that duplicates the queue entry. Flush it from the Moderation panel instead. For anything weirder than that, reach the Vendor Ops desk here.

pager mailbox: belion.norael.ralvan@urlaqnet.local

## Welcome, Plugin Authors!

Hey — glad you're building on the Lotview garage occupancy feed. Your plugin polls stall counts from our sandbox first, so don't worry about breaking anything real. One thing people trip on: if your sandbox token expires mid-session, the feed returns empty floors instead of an error. Annoying, we know. To reset, hit the recovery endpoint from your dashboard and, when the dialog asks, supply the passphrase given below.

strongbox words: sorir-belvan-rusix-ulays-ralmir-praix-eliir-tamax-praael-druael-julir-tamius-jorir